Summary
Corticosteroid injections combined with physical therapy significantly improved frozen shoulder outcomes compared to platelet-rich plasma or saline injections. All treatments showed improvement, but corticosteroids were superior, especially in the early freezing stage.

Background:
- Frozen shoulder (adhesive capsulitis) is a debilitating condition characterized by pain and restricted range of motion.
- Current treatment options include physical therapy, corticosteroid injections, and emerging regenerative therapies like platelet-rich plasma.
Purpose of the Study:
- To compare the efficacy of combined glenohumeral joint (GHJ) and subacromial-subdeltoid (SASD) bursa injections of platelet-rich plasma (PRP), corticosteroids (CSs), or normal saline (NS), alongside physical therapy (PT), for treating frozen shoulder.
Main Methods:
- A prospective, single-blinded, randomized controlled trial was conducted with 90 patients diagnosed with primary frozen shoulder.
- Participants were randomized into three groups: PRP + PT, CS + PT, or NS + NS + PT.
- Ultrasound-guided injections targeted both the GHJ and SASD bursa, with outcomes assessed at baseline and 1, 2, 4, and 6 months post-treatment.
Main Results:
- The corticosteroid (CS) group demonstrated statistically significant improvements in the Shoulder Pain and Disability Index (SPADI), Shoulder Disability Questionnaire (SDQ), pain visual analog scale (VAS), active and passive range of motion, patient self-assessment, and SF-36 scores compared to PRP and NS groups.
- These benefits were observed as early as 1 month and sustained through the 6-month follow-up period.
Conclusions:
- Corticosteroid injections, in combination with physical therapy, are more effective than PRP or NS injections for treating frozen shoulder, particularly during the initial freezing stage.
- While CSs showed superior results, all investigated treatment modalities led to significant improvements in patient outcomes.
